Common Home Foundation Installation Jobs
Basement Foundations - ensuring a stable base for underground spaces and additional living areas.
Slab Foundations - providing a level, durable surface for residential and commercial structures.
Pier and Beam Foundations - elevating buildings to prevent moisture issues and accommodate uneven terrain.
Concrete Footings - supporting the load of the entire structure and preventing settling.
Foundation Repair - addressing issues like cracks, settling, or water damage to preserve stability.
Foundation Waterproofing - protecting the foundation from water intrusion and related structural problems.
Home Foundation Installation Questions
What types of foundation installation services are available? Services include installing new foundations for homes, additions, and commercial buildings, as well as underpinning and slab setups.
How do I know if my property needs foundation installation? Sign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or flooring, and doors or windows that don’t close properly.
What materials are used for foundation installation? Common materials include concrete, reinforced concrete, and sometimes steel or gravel for specific projects.
What should property owners consider before starting foundation work? It's important to evaluate soil conditions, property layout, and any existing structural issues before beginning installation.
